Chapter 16

I decided it would be best to give the polar bears a miss.

‘All right,’ Beamish agreed. ‘I suppose we have been gone a while. I’ll show them to you when we come back to see the wonderland.’

‘I’m not sure we should do that now,’ I told him, slipping a little on the path but refusing the offer of his arm.

‘Why ever not?’

Because my boyfriend wouldn’t like it, because you make me feel things I shouldn’t and I think you feel them too, because we can’t seem to spend any time alone together without almost falling on each other’s lips . . .

‘Not because of what just happened?’ he said, stopping. ‘I thought you said I hadn’t ruined your day?’

‘No,’ I said, ‘not because of what just almost happened.’

‘What then?’

‘I just don’t want . . .’ I answered, thinking of the ideas Anna and Molly already seemed to have, ‘anyone getting the wrong idea about us spending so much time together, that’s all.’

‘What does it matter what anyone else thinks?’ He frowned. ‘Besides,’ he added, before striding off again, ‘we’re just friends and given the fact that we’re both free and single how much time we spend together is no one else’s business, is it?’

I felt my festive flame flicker in the wake of his words.

‘But if it helps,’ he said seriously, ‘I promise I won’t try and kiss you again. Let’s put what just almost happened back there down as a moment of madness, nothing more. Let’s say, I was simply seduced by the magic of the Wishing Tree.’

‘All right,’ I agreed, happy to let it drop. ‘No more near-kisses and I’ll come to see the wonderland with you.’

‘Near-kisses?’ He grinned. ‘I thought there’d only been one?’

I put my head down and carried on walking.

I returned the clothes and wellies I had borrowed and after we had said our goodbyes back in the hall kitchen, and offered our truly heartfelt thanks for the wonderful visit, Beamish drove Dolly and me back to the cottage. I didn’t have to worry about how I was going to fill any awkward silences because Dolly’s excitement didn’t allow for any. Her steady stream of reminiscing didn’t require any input from either Beamish or me and I was grateful that she didn’t ask if we had enjoyed our wander around the grounds.

‘Are you expecting a parcel?’ I asked as we pulled up at the cottage gate and I spotted something propped up against the front door.

‘Oh yes,’ said Dolly as Beamish helped her out of the truck. ‘I’d quite forgotten about that. It’s for you, Hattie.’

‘Me?’

‘Yes.’

‘What is it?’

‘An early Christmas present.’

‘Another one,’ I said, thinking of the advent calendar.

‘Another one,’ she smiled.

‘Can I open it now?’ I asked.

‘No,’ she said, ‘it’s for tomorrow. It’s my contribution,’ she explained, picking the parcel up as I unlocked the door, ‘to ensuring that this Friday the thirteenth is memorable for far happier reasons than the last.’

‘What happened on the last?’ asked Beamish.

‘The poor girl was made redundant from her job,’ said Dolly.
